Understanding the Hazards: Safety Data Sheets (SDS)

The primary source of information regarding the safety of any chemical is its Safety Data Sheet (SDS). Reputable 4-Fluoro-2-methoxyaniline suppliers provide comprehensive SDS documents. These documents detail:

  • Identification of Hazards: This section outlines potential risks, such as skin irritation, eye irritation, and respiratory tract irritation, which are common for aniline derivatives.
  • First-Aid Measures: Instructions on immediate actions to take in case of exposure (inhalation, skin contact, eye contact, ingestion).
  • Fire-Fighting Measures: Information on suitable extinguishing media and protective equipment for firefighters.
  • Accidental Release Measures: Procedures for containment and clean-up of spills to prevent environmental contamination.
  • Handling and Storage: Recommendations for safe handling practices and appropriate storage conditions to maintain product integrity and safety.
  • Exposure Controls/Personal Protection: Guidance on engineering controls and necessary Personal Protective Equipment (PPE).

Essential Personal Protective Equipment (PPE)

When working with 4-Fluoro-2-methoxyaniline, appropriate PPE is mandatory. This typically includes:

  • Eye Protection: Chemical safety goggles or a face shield to protect against splashes.
  • Skin Protection: Chemical-resistant gloves (e.g., nitrile, neoprene), lab coats, and potentially aprons or full protective suits depending on the scale of operation and risk of exposure.
  • Respiratory Protection: If ventilation is inadequate or there's a risk of aerosol formation, a respirator with appropriate filters (e.g., for organic vapors) may be necessary.

Safe Handling and Storage Practices

To ensure safe operations when you purchase 4-Fluoro-2-methoxyaniline:

  • Ventilation: Always handle the chemical in a well-ventilated area, preferably under a fume hood, to minimize inhalation exposure.
  • Avoid Contact: Prevent contact with skin, eyes, and clothing. Wash thoroughly after handling.
  • Storage: Store in tightly closed containers in a cool, dry place, away from incompatible materials. Suppliers often recommend specific storage temperatures, such as 2-8 °C, for optimal preservation.
  • Spill Management: Have appropriate spill kits readily available and ensure personnel are trained in their use.
